Curiosity with fire is normal among children. But, setting fires should not be considered "normal" behavior.
Firesetting by children and adolescents is a major concern to fire departments across the Central Oklahoma metropolitan area as well as the nation. Child set fires are the leading cause of hospital burn admissions for children under age five and a leading cause of home and school property loss.
Operation FireSAFE is the region’s juvenile firesetting prevention program that offers information and counseling to children who have played with or started fires.
